Artist history
magnet2metal formed in the cold winter of 2001. Sarah G. Brown and Aaron T. Davis found the sounds that they were producing seperately came together instantly upon the first practice.

Magnet2metal is playing shows all over the area and is willing to play to audiences great and small. Current plans include recording in a studio and to continue with writing and playing shows when they get them. "We are going to do great things together" - Sarah G. Brown

Additional info
Sarah G. Brown "the magnet" & Aaron T. Davis "the metal" compose and execute a hybrid of organic sound interlaced with electronic devices. Creating an all original music, Magnet2metal is influenced by folk & improv artists, and performers like Led Zeppelin, Bjork, The Golden Palominos, The Cure, Moby, and Pink Floyd.

Magnet2metal has been known to fly to Chicago to play 20 minutes, in dingy anarchist dens. The music before you ranges from raw 4 track sketches to early experimental mixes. These songs are stripped down and in their freshest form(lessness) the paintings are no where near dry.
